Property Insights of (3H)granisetron

The XLogP value of 2.8 suggests moderate lipophilicity, balancing water solubility and membrane permeability for (3H)granisetron. With a topological polar surface area (TPSA) of 50.2 Ų, (3H)granisetron ex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, (3H)granisetron has 1 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
